Create a trinomial. Write it in ascending order and identify its degree.

hartnn (hartnn):

A trinomial is an expression with 3 different terms....can u think of any 3 different terms?

OpenStudy (anonymous):

Uhmm, Not really.. ):

hartnn (hartnn):

ok, let me give an example, 3 terms--->1,x,x^2 ascending order--->1+x+x^2 degree = highest exponent = 2 got this?
